An intensive programme for pelvic floor muscle exercises: short- and long-term effects on those with stress urinary incontinence.

Abstract

Pelvic floor muscle exercises for the treatment of stress urinary incontinence were reported 45 years ago. However, few studies have been made on the long-term outcome and clinical effects in elderly people. We put 123 incontinent women on an intensive exercise programme for 8 weeks and followed them for more than 12 months; 15 patients were over 65 years old and 108 under 65 years old. Self-reported success rates, i.e., cure or a reduction of > 50% of the original severity, were prospectively assessed in the 2 groups immediately and a mean of 28 months (12-52) after the training. Predictive parameters for an immediate and a long-term success were assessed. The intensive programme depended on patients being motivated, patient education, correct muscle contractions, and the keeping of treatment diaries for 8 weeks. Urine loss evaluated objectively and bothersome scores in 6 activities assessed subjectively improved only in the younger adult group. However, vaginal contractile strength increased in both groups. The immediate success rate was 20% and 40% for the elderly and the adults, respectively. Twenty eight months later, the success rate was 27% for the aged and 40% for the adults with 6 patients becoming continent by surgery. Both the short- and long-term success rates were similar in the 2 groups (p < 0.05). 95% of the patients stated that the intensive training was valuable and that they would recommend the training to friends suffering from stress incontinence. Contractile strength of the vagina can be used to predict the immediate treatment outcome, but there are no parameters for predicting the long-term success. In conclusion, the intensive programme of pelvic floor muscle exercises is an effective treatment option for not only for the young adults but also for elderly people suffering from stress incontinence.

45年前就有关于盆底肌肉锻炼治疗压力性尿失禁的报道。然而,针对老年人的长期疗效和临床效果的研究却很少。我们让123名尿失禁女性参加了为期8周的强化锻炼计划,并对她们进行了超过12个月的跟踪;其中15名患者年龄超过65岁,108名患者年龄在65岁以下。前瞻性地评估了两组患者在训练后即刻以及平均28个月(12 - 52个月)后的自我报告成功率,即治愈或症状严重程度减轻超过50%。评估了即刻成功和长期成功的预测参数。强化计划依赖于患者的积极性、患者教育、正确的肌肉收缩以及8周的治疗日记记录。客观评估的尿量减少以及主观评估的6项活动中的困扰评分仅在年轻成年组有所改善。然而,两组的阴道收缩力均有所增加。老年人和成年人的即刻成功率分别为20%和40%。28个月后,老年人的成功率为27%,成年人的成功率为40%,有6名患者通过手术实现了尿失禁治愈。两组的短期和长期成功率相似(p < 0.05)。95%的患者表示强化训练很有价值,并会向患有压力性尿失禁的朋友推荐该训练。阴道收缩力可用于预测即刻治疗效果,但尚无预测长期成功的参数。总之,盆底肌肉锻炼的强化计划不仅是年轻成年人,也是患有压力性尿失禁的老年人的一种有效治疗选择。
